NTT WiFi Hotspot 2012/3/12 14:23
Hi Guys,
Ill be in japan in 2 weeks and want to subscribe to wifi hotspot.
Do I just sign up when I get there or is there something else I can do?

Is NTT the only provider for WiFi?
I want to use my smartphone, I don't want to hire a dongle.

Re: NTT WiFi Hotspot 2012/3/15 09:50
Ill be in japan in 2 weeks and want to subscribe to wifi hotspot.
Do I just sign up when I get there or is there something else I can do?


Yes, you can just sign up on a per day basis. You will need to be able to read Japanese, and some services may only accept Japanese credit cards. Paid wifi typically costs 500 yen/day.

Alternatively, check out Skype Wifi. That will allow you to connect and pay via your home currency and language. Note that their prices are more expensive than paid wifi day passes but provide you with more flexibility when connecting.

http://www.skype.com/intl/en/features/allfeatures/skype-wifi/

Is NTT the only provider for WiFi?

No, there are dozens of paid wifi providers.
